Multi-Region AWS Architecture with Failover

aws · network diagram.

About This Architecture

Multi-region AWS architecture deploys ECS Fargate microservices (API, Auth, Worker) across us-east-1 and us-west-2 with automated failover. Route 53 health checks direct CloudFront traffic to active Application Load Balancers, while RDS PostgreSQL replicates from primary to read replica and ElastiCache Redis clusters maintain session state in both regions. SQS queues handle background jobs, S3 stores file uploads, and CodePipeline with CodeBuild deploys containers to ECR across regions, with CloudWatch, X-Ray, and Secrets Manager providing observability and secrets management. This architecture demonstrates AWS best practices for geographic redundancy, minimizing RTO/RPO for mission-critical workloads requiring 99.99% availability. Fork this diagram on Diagrams.so to customize VPC CIDR ranges, add additional regions, or integrate AWS Global Accelerator for improved failover performance.

People also ask

How do I design a multi-region AWS architecture with automated failover for ECS Fargate applications?

Deploy ECS Fargate services in two regions with Route 53 health checks directing CloudFront traffic to active Application Load Balancers. Replicate RDS PostgreSQL across regions and maintain ElastiCache Redis clusters in both, as shown in this AWS multi-region failover diagram.

Multi-Region AWS Architecture with Failover

AWSadvancedECS FargateMulti-RegionHigh AvailabilityDisaster RecoveryMicroservices
Domain: Cloud AwsAudience: AWS solutions architects designing high-availability multi-region applications
3 views0 favoritesPublic

Created by

February 14, 2026

Updated

April 1, 2026 at 7:00 AM

Type

network

Need a custom architecture diagram?

Describe your architecture in plain English and get a production-ready Draw.io diagram in seconds. Works for AWS, Azure, GCP, Kubernetes, and more.

Generate with AI